Mastering Modern Web Development with Coding ReactJS and WordPress

Explore the dynamic world of modern web development through the lens of coding, ReactJS, and WordPress. This article delves into the programming essentials, the component-based React library, and the versatility of WordPress as a content management system to empower your web projects in a seamless and efficient way.

Integrating Coding Skills with ReactJS and WordPress for Effective Web Development

Coding forms the foundational bedrock of web development, including languages such as HTML, CSS, JavaScript, PHP and MySQL. These elements work together to build the architecture, presentation, and functionality of a website or web application. In particular, HTML and CSS provide the structural and stylistic base, while JavaScript enhances interactivity and dynamic features.

ReactJS, a JavaScript library created by Facebook, is considered one of the most prominent tools for building user interfaces (UI). With its component-based architecture, ReactJS encourages reusable components that can be used across different parts of a web application, leading to more efficient code, improved system coherence and less time spent on debugging. Moreover, React’s support for declarative programming simplifies the coding process, making it easier to create interactive UIs that efficiently update and render just the right components in your application as your data changes.

On the other hand, WordPress is the world’s most popular open-source content management system, powering over 30% of websites on the internet. It is built primarily using PHP and MySQL. WordPress’s main strength lies in its flexible plugin and theme architecture, which allows for extensive customization without the need for deep coding knowledge. Themes control the presentation and layout of a website, while plugins add extra functionality, transforming a simple blog into a fully-featured e-commerce platform, community forum, or just about any type of website conceivable.

ReactJS, when integrated with WordPress, brings about a powerful synergy that combines the robustness of React’s UI components with the flexibility of WordPress’s content management capabilities. This allows developers to build dynamic, interactive applications and websites that are user-friendly, performance-optimized, and highly customizable. Leveraging WordPress themes and plugins extends site functionality and improves user experience. Through the use of React hooks, state and lifecycle features from function components can be added, allowing seamless state management and side effects handling.

Mastering these technologies and integrating coding skills, ReactJS, and WordPress, developers can build modern, scalable, and maintainable websites. This combination embraces the power of coding for web development and opens a plethora of opportunities for creating impactful and immersive web experiences.

Conclusions

Combining coding fundamentals with the powerful capabilities of ReactJS and WordPress offers a robust approach to modern web development. By mastering these tools, developers can build responsive, efficient, and scalable web applications while managing content effortlessly. This integrative skill set not only streamlines workflow but also opens opportunities for innovative web experiences.

Leave a Comment

Scroll to Top